  • Jimmy Graham on Saints-Falcons Rivalry & His Quest to Row the Arctic Ocean
    Feb 19 2025

    On this episode of Off the Edge with Cam Jordan, Cam is joined by his former teammate and five-time Pro Bowler Jimmy Graham. They discuss the bittersweet feeling of the Super Bowl LIX being hosted in New Orleans and whether any team rivalry has ever came close to matching Saints vs. Falcons. Jimmy also dives into the Arctic Challenge he’s preparing for, the brutal training he’s endured, and what inspired him to take on such an extreme adventure.

  • Jameis Winston on Being Named NFL's Most Unintentionally Funny Player, His Conversation with Myles Garrett , + What Was in the Briefcase?
    Feb 11 2025

    On this episode of Off the Edge with Cam Jordan, Cam is joined by someone who has gone viral time and time again for his unforgettable one-liners and iconic speeches—his friend and former teammate, Jameis Winston.

    Jameis shares some of his favorite moments working for Fox Sports as a digital correspondent during Super Bowl weekend in New Orleans, including his experience learning to tap dance.

    The conversation then shifts to Myles Garrett’s trade request from the Browns. Jameis discusses a recent conversation he had with Myles, shedding light on why Myles made the request and his thoughts on the Browns’ organization and the culture Myles Garrett felt deprived of.

    Jameis also discusses his upcoming free agency, reflecting on the ideal fit for his next chapter in the NFL. He addresses being named the “NFL’s Most Unintentionally Funny Player” and clears up whether there was anything in his briefcase—and if he actually gave a speech with an empty briefcase as an analogy for “nothing getting between them.”

  • Patrick Surtain II on Winning DPOY + Gerald McCoy on the NFC South Rivalry
    Feb 8 2025

    On this episode of Off the Edge, Cam Jordan first sits down with the 2024 AP NFL Defensive Player of the Year, Patrick Surtain II. Patrick reflects on his award-winning season, sharing how he manifested the achievement and how it feels to accomplish such a big goal. The two also dive into the evolving NIL landscape, exploring both its positives and its potential to impact competition and loyalty in college football. Patrick also talks about the legendary coaches in the AFC West and what gives him confidence that his team can rise to the top of the division.

    Then, Cam is joined by NFL Network analyst and six-time Pro Bowler Gerald McCoy. They discuss the Buccaneers' four straight NFC South titles and break down what truly defines an NFC South rival. Gerald also shares who his favorite quarterback to play with was, and the QB he loved sacking the most. The conversation shifts to Ben Roethlisberger’s legacy and whether he’ll get into the Hall of Fame, followed by a debate on what it really takes to earn that coveted spot. Finally, Gerald gives his Super Bowl prediction, explaining why experience will triumph in the big game.
